Understanding the Basics of Water-Filters

Water-filters are crucial in purifying drinking water by effectively removing many impurities and contaminants. These can range from common sediments and chlorine to harmful substances like lead. The presence of such impurities compromises the taste and odor of your water and can pose significant health risks over time. The core functionality of water-filters revolves around a sophisticated filtration system. This system is designed to trap and isolate contaminants, ensuring that the water that flows out is clean, safe, and suitable for drinking.

The operation of water-filters involves several stages, each targeting specific contaminants. Initially, water passes through a pre-filter stage, which captures larger particles such as sediment and rust. Following this, it may undergo several more purification stages, depending on the complexity of the filtration technology used. These stages can include activated carbon filtration, which is effective at removing chlorine and organic compounds, and possibly even a post-filter phase to polish the water before consumption.

The result is a significant reduction in the concentration of harmful substances, delivering water that is safer and more palatable. Types of Water-Filters Available on the Market

Navigating the diverse landscape of water filtration options can be daunting for anyone seeking to enhance the quality of their drinking water. The market presents a variety of water-filters, each utilizing unique filtration technologies to target specific impurities.  Among the prevalent types, activated carbon filters stand out for their efficiency in adsorbing organic compounds and chlorine, significantly improving taste and odor.

Reverse osmosis (RO) filters offer another level of purification, employing a semi-permeable membrane to eliminate a broad spectrum of contaminants, including salts and fluoride, providing remarkably pure water. UV filters take a different approach, leveraging ultraviolet light to neutralize bacteria and viruses, making them an excellent choice for eradicating biological contaminants. Additionally, sediment filters are designed to capture large particulate matter like dirt and rust, often serving as a preliminary filtration stage in more complex systems.

Ion-exchange filters are particularly effective in softening water, as they exchange ions with contaminants to remove heavy metals and reduce lime scale. Each type of filter brings its own set of benefits and is engineered to address specific water quality concerns. Key Features to Look for in the Best Water Filter

Selecting the best water filter requires consideration of several key features that determine its effectiveness, convenience, and overall value. Here are five essential aspects to keep in mind:

Filtration Technology

Look for advanced methods such as reverse osmosis, activated carbon, or UV filtration targeting a broad spectrum of contaminants. The technology should align with the specific impurities present in your water supply.

Certifications

Opt for water-filters independently tested and certified by reputable organizations like NSF International or the Water Quality Association. Certifications ensure that the filter meets stringent health and safety standards.

Capacity and Flow Rate

Consider the filtered water you need daily. The filter should have sufficient capacity and a flow rate that meets your household’s water consumption without significant waiting times.

Ease of Installation and Maintenance

The best water-filters are easy to install and maintain. Look for systems with user-friendly instructions and simple filter replacement processes to reduce hassle and ensure consistent water quality.

Cost-Efficiency

Evaluate the initial purchase price in conjunction with the ongoing costs of filter replacements. A cost-efficient water-filter balances upfront investment and long-term savings on filter replacements and maintenance.

How to Properly Maintain Your Water-Filter for Longevity?

Maintaining your water filter is crucial for ensuring it continues to provide the highest quality without compromising safety or taste.

  • The first step is adhering to the manufacturer’s guidelines for filter replacement. Different filters have varying lifespans, and using them beyond this period can reduce their efficacy in trapping contaminants. This means replacing the filter cartridge every three to six months for most water-filters, although the exact timeframe depends on your specific model and water usage.
  • In addition to regular cartridge changes, it’s important to clean the system itself. This involves dismantling the parts according to the manufacturer’s instructions and cleaning the components with a mild soap solution or a vinegar-water mix. Rinse thoroughly to prevent any cleaning solution from contaminating your water.
  • Sanitizing the water filter is another key maintenance task. Use a sanitizing solution recommended by the filter’s manufacturer and follow the instructions carefully to ensure all parts are properly treated. This step is especially important in areas with high bacterial contamination in the water supply.
  • Finally, keep an eye on the filter’s performance. A noticeable decrease in water flow or a change in taste or odor could indicate that the filter needs attention sooner than expected. By taking these proactive steps, you can help extend the life of your water filter, ensuring it continues to provide safe, clean drinking water.

DIY Water-Filter Solutions for the Budget-Conscious

DIY water-filter solutions present a practical and affordable option for individuals looking to purify their drinking water without breaking the bank. These homemade systems can utilize common household materials such as activated charcoal, sand, and gravel, offering a straightforward approach to reducing contaminants. By assembling layers of these materials in a proper container, one can create a basic yet effective filtration system that targets various particles and impurities.

One popular DIY method involves creating a charcoal filter using activated charcoal, a material known for its adsorption properties. This type of filter can effectively remove certain chemicals and improve the taste and odor of water. Similarly, sand and gravel filters can be constructed to remove larger particulates and sediments from the water physically.

Though these DIY solutions may not achieve the high-level purification found in commercial water-filters, they are a significant first step toward cleaner water for those on a tight budget. It’s important to note, however, that homemade filters require more frequent maintenance and monitoring to ensure they continue to function effectively. Additionally, they might be less efficient in removing certain pollutants, such as heavy metals or bacteria, so they should be considered a part of a comprehensive approach to water purification rather than a complete solution on their own.

Q: Can a water filter remove all types of contaminants?

A: No single water filter can remove all types of contaminants. Different filters are designed to target specific substances, so it’s essential to understand the specific contaminants present in your water supply and select a filter that is effective against those concerns. Combining multiple filtration methods, such as in a water-filter machine, can provide broader protection against a range of contaminants.
